12a^2 + 84ab + 147b^2
---
A little trick:
If you graph this as 12x^2 + 84x + 147 you
will see that -7/2 is a root.
---
That means 2x+7 is a factor.
---
Your problem:
= (2a+7b)(6a+21b)
